Renée Zellweger to Star in Netflix Drama ‘What/If’

Renee Zellweger. Photo by Chelsea Lauren/Variety/REX/Shutterstock (9134653cd)

Renée Zellweger is heading to television for her first-ever TV series regular role.

The Oscar-winning actress has been tapped to star n Netflix’s upcoming anthology What/If. 

The drama helmed by Revenge and Swingtown creator Mike Kelley has been greenlit for 10 episodes.

According to the streaming giant, What/If will explore “the ripple effects of what happens when acceptable people start doing unacceptable things. Each season will tackle a different morality tale inspired by culturally consequential source materials and the power of a single fateful decision to change the trajectory of an entire life.”

Kelley will serve as showrunner and will pen the script. He will exec produce alongside Melissa Loy, Alex Gartner, Charles Roven, Robert Zemeckis, and Jack Rapke.

Zellweger will portray Anne. According to The Hollywood Reporter, the first installment might focus on newlyweds, however, details about the plot and characters are being kept under wraps.
